In the role you will:

  • Be responsible for delivering the quality strategy for your category ensuring legal, safe and fit for purpose products are available for customers, with the aim of reducing customer complaints, faulty returns and negative customer reviews.
  • Conduct product risk assessments, technical benchmarking, and user trials to ensure products meet brand guidelines.
  • Approve samples, packaging, copy, instruction manuals and relevant documentation in line with the critical path, meeting agreed timescales to deliver products for sale.
  • Organise in line and pre shipment inspections.
  • Coordinate with testing houses and suppliers to ensure your products are meeting standards complying with legislation in the UK and other countries.
  • Analyse returns and agree corrective action plans/improvements.
  • Provide technical advice and support to buying and customer service teams.
  • Report into the Head of Technical.
